thats well worth the price man.

Its a very good deck, I got my friend the Premier version to it.

It has 3 6 volt pre-outs. Plays MP3's.

Has HP and LP x overs on it.

Has pretty much all the bells and whistles on it. Not a bad looking HU at all.

$150 is a steal on it. Deffinately pick it up if its the 7600.

I may be wrong about the pre-out voltage on the deck though, the Premier units sometimes have a higher pre-out voltage than the regular Pioneer models. But if anything minimum pre-out voltage that 7600 has is 4volt, which is still good.
